The minute the announcement was made, the conspiracy theories began swirling. Clay Buchholz had barely finished his most recent ho-hum start at Pawtucket Sunday afternoon when the Red Sox announced he—and not a pitcher already in the five-man rotation—would make the first start for the big league club following the All-Star break.Why? Whispers have included everything from the possible (he’s being showcased for a potential trade, perhaps for Toronto ace Roy Halladay) to the probable (they want to give him another look at the MLB level so they know what to expect going forward) to the borderline preposterous (the Red Sox are pretending to showcase the youngster in order to entice the Yankees to overpay for Halladay).The latter nugget is courtesy of Michael Felger, as delivered on Comcast SportsNet last night.
